Hey folks — quick handover on the Tollgate billing worker. We run blue-green: green takes traffic only after the ledger reconciliation check passes, and rollback is just flipping the router back. Don't skip the drain step or you'll double-charge retries. Deploy artifacts have to be signed, and the current key is below.

rollout seal: bky6_UcUHab

Minutes — Management Meeting, Tovren Goods. Attendees: senior team. Topic: pilot with the Marlet & Finch retail chain. Twelve stores confirmed, eight weeks, starting next month. Stock allocation approved. Success metric: sell-through above 60%. Risks: logistics capacity, shelf placement terms. Incoming director owns the review. Strategic context for the pilot appears below.

board note of fahif-yahog: Gross margin on Wenath came in at 10 percent against a plan of 5 percent. Only 3 of the 100 pilot accounts renewed Wenath, so a churn review is set for July 15.

## Changelog — Ticktrace 1.9

### Renamed: DRIFT_API_TOKEN
During the cron drift investigation we found plugins confusing this variable with the metrics token, so it has been renamed to indicate it authorizes drift-report uploads specifically. Plugin authors must read the new name from 1.9 onward; the old name is ignored without warning. Sample env files in the SDK are updated. In your deployment env file, the drift-report upload secret is set on the next line.

env line for fawef-taguf: VAULT_KEY13=a9695905a9a90